| 1375522 | 2014-05-22 08:39:00 | My mail program is windows live mail, which has failed to start. Details that I can find are :- Server pop3.xtra.co.nz, Protocol pop3, Port 110, SSL = no, Socket error 10061 From the above, can anyone see what might be the problem ? |

| 1375523 | 2014-05-22 08:45:00 | Try setting the setting to what xtra are now using. A short while back they stopped using the old settings for the secure ones. Xtra Settings Windows Live mail (help.telecom.co.nz 3D) With those instruction from Xtra, since theres an existing account, select Properties NOT email ( this is for a new account only) Heres what that error code means: Connection refused. No connection could be made because the target computer actively refused it. This usually results from trying to connect to a service that is inactive on the foreign host—that is, one with no server application running. |
